Sony revealed its newest full-frame premium compact camera, the Cybershot RX1R. The camera is exactly the same in terms of functionality and operation as Sony’s RX1 that has seen excellent sales since its launch last year; the only difference is that the RX1R has no antialiasing filter. Panasonic announces revised version of classic lens
Panasonic announced the Lumix G 20mm F/1.7 II ASPH, a revised version of its classic fast pancake lens for Micro Four Thirds system cameras. Dubbed the H-HS020A, the new lens seems to be unchanged from its predecessor in its optical design, with 7 elements in 5 groups, including 2 aspheric elements. Cosina announces mid-range telephoto lens
Cosina Co. announced that it was developing a new mid-range telephoto lens – the NOKTON 42.5mm F/0.95 – for compact cameras with micro four thirds sensor systems. The lens is equivalent to 85mm F/0.95 in 35mm format, and its wide aperture size of F/0.95 is expected to make it highly suitable for portrait photography. Samsung introduces new Android-based camera
Samsung launched the Galaxy NX, the world’s first interchangeable lens camera to run the Android OS. The camera is a 20.3MP SLR-type camera, with added features like 3G/4G LTE/Wi- Fi connectivity, Android 4.2 ( Jelly Bean), and a 4.8” HD LCD touchscreen.
